参加第三届阿里中间件的代码 复赛18名
包含代码和技术文档
凭借复赛代码获邀参加决赛,并在与阿里工程师同台竞技的24小时编程挑战赛中获得第9名
主要设计亮点包括:
1 自行设计与实现的无锁队列
2 填充法解决CPU伪共享问题
3 批读+并发处理+顺序合并
4 令牌环与自旋锁
5 Socket通信
6 存储结构优化与重写HashMap
7 insert操作提前
详细见文档
没有合适的资源?快使用搜索试试~ 我知道了~
温馨提示
【资源说明】 1、该资源包括项目的全部源码,下载可以直接使用! 2、本项目适合作为计算机、数学、电子信息等专业的课程设计、期末大作业和毕设项目,作为参考资料学习借鉴。 3、本资源作为“参考资料”如果需要实现其他功能,需要能看懂代码,并且热爱钻研,自行调试。 2017阿里第三届中间件大赛参赛源码+项目说明(复赛18名).zip
资源推荐
资源详情
资源评论
收起资源包目录
2017阿里第三届中间件大赛参赛源码+项目说明(复赛18名).zip (53个子文件)
code_20105
.classpath 1KB
.settings
org.eclipse.core.resources.prefs 60B
org.eclipse.m2e.core.prefs 86B
pom.xml 4KB
src
resources
logback.xml 3KB
assembly.xml 386B
main
java
com
alibaba
middleware
race
sync
Client.java 4KB
Kernel.java 2KB
MessageStore.java 2KB
Constants.java 1KB
SubThread.java 4KB
Server.java 4KB
HashMap4.java 5KB
ClientIdleEventHandler.java 2KB
ClientDemoInHandler.java 5KB
UnBlockQueue.java 912B
target
classes
logback.xml 3KB
assembly.xml 386B
com
alibaba
middleware
race
sync
HashMap3$Entry.class 3KB
Server.class 3KB
cunchu.class 434B
AbstractMap1$2.class 2KB
AbstractMap1$1$1.class 1KB
AbstractMap1$SimpleEntry.class 3KB
Kernel.class 3KB
AbstractMap1.class 7KB
HashMap1.class 1KB
HashMap3$EntrySet.class 2KB
AbstractMap1$1.class 1KB
HashMap4.class 3KB
UnBlockQueue.class 1KB
AbstractMap1$2$1.class 1KB
SubThread.class 3KB
Client$1.class 1KB
HashMap3$ValueIterator.class 1KB
MessageStore.class 2KB
HashMap3$EntryIterator.class 1KB
HashMap2.class 1KB
AbstractMap1$SimpleImmutableEntry.class 3KB
cunchu2.class 436B
Constants.class 784B
HashMap3$KeyIterator.class 1KB
Client.class 4KB
HashMap3$HashIterator.class 2KB
ClientIdleEventHandler.class 3KB
ClientDemoInHandler.class 2KB
HashMap3$KeySet.class 2KB
HashMap4$Entry.class 1KB
HashMap3$Values.class 1KB
HashMap3.class 14KB
技术文档.docx 228KB
.project 533B
README.md 455B
共 53 条
- 1
资源评论
土豆片片
- 粉丝: 1567
- 资源: 5642
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功